DocumentCode
1466800
Title
Group communication in partitionable systems: specification and algorithms
Author
Babaoglu, Özalp ; Davoli, Renzo ; Montresor, Alberto
Author_Institution
Dept. of Comput. Sci., Bologna Univ., Italy
Volume
27
Issue
4
fYear
2001
fDate
4/1/2001 12:00:00 AM
Firstpage
308
Lastpage
336
Abstract
Gives a formal specification and an implementation for a partitionable group communication service in asynchronous distributed systems. Our specification is motivated by the requirements for building “partition-aware” applications that can continue operating without blocking in multiple concurrent partitions and can reconfigure themselves dynamically when partitions merge. The specified service guarantees liveness and excludes trivial solutions, it constitutes a useful basis for building realistic partition-aware applications, and it is implementable in practical asynchronous distributed systems where certain stability conditions hold
Keywords
distributed processing; fault tolerant computing; formal specification; stability criteria; algorithms; asynchronous distributed systems; concurrent partitions; dynamic reconfiguration; fault tolerance; formal specification; liveness; partition merging; partition-aware applications; partitionable group communication service; specification; stability conditions; view synchrony; Application software; Computer Society; Computer applications; Computer networks; Degradation; Fault tolerant systems; Formal specifications; Mobile computing; Partitioning algorithms; Stability;
fLanguage
English
Journal_Title
Software Engineering, IEEE Transactions on
Publisher
ieee
ISSN
0098-5589
Type
jour
DOI
10.1109/32.917522
Filename
917522
Link To Document